§ 30.053 — SUPERINTENDENT OF THE TEXAS SCHOOL FOR THE DEAF

ED § 30.053Title 2. PUBLIC EDUCATION · Part F. CURRICULUM, PROGRAMS, AND SERVICES · Ch. 30. STATE AND REGIONAL PROGRAMS AND SERVICES · Art. C. TEXAS SCHOOL FOR THE DEAF

Statute text

View on source
(a)The superintendent of the Texas School for the Deaf is appointed by the governing board of the school.
(b)The superintendent must:
(1)hold an advanced degree in the field of education;
(2)have teaching and administrative experience in programs serving students who are deaf; and
(3)satisfy any other requirements the board establishes.
(c)The superintendent may reside at the school.
